The only way a floor mount tank type toilet would fit tight to the wall would be if the plumber knew exactly how far the opening had to be from the finished wall and also knew how thick the finished wall would be from the framing.
The most standard rough in dimension is 12 inches but some toilets call for a 10 inch or 14 inch rough in.
Confirm the rough in dimension with the toilet installation instructions or manufacturer.

If the toilet has four closet bolts measure to the center of one of the rear ones.
Measure from the center of the mounting holes to the back of the new toilet you re considering.
The distance from the flange s center to the back wall is known as the toilet rough in dimension.
